         | kg wrote:
         | Sometimes it's both. I had some crazy data corruption problems
         | that turned out to be a one-two punch of a buggy anti-cheat
         | driver from a game I was playing _and_ a defective M.2 SSD slot
         | on my motherboard. Without the combination of both factors
         | everything was fine, but when I played the game with that slot
         | populated, the disk in that slot started getting corrupted and
         | failing to respond to requests from the OS (eventually hanging
         | the system).
         | 
         | Wild troubleshooting adventure.

           | parl_match wrote:
           | > It really gives the game away.
           | 
           | Does it?
           | 
           | That kingston ram is DDR5-5600, with smaller memory sizes,
           | and has a longer warranty. This suggests that the product is
           | binned memory from a line that is relatively mature (and by
           | extension low failure rates).
           | 
           | And, because it's clocked lower, it runs cooler, which
           | reduces failure rate.
           | 
           | On top of that, server memory is usually binned more
           | strictly. And, it usually has bits missing for ECC, custom
           | controller firmware, and cutting edge processes for packing
           | more memory into the form factor.
           | 
           | Now as a consumer you may think an LED is "riced" out, but I
           | think custom firmware on your ram built for your application
           | is way more "riced".
           | 
           | > None of that stuff actually helps
           | 
           | It probably actually does, especially for "high end" ram. IE
           | stuff running at much higher transfer rates. Heat and voltage
           | are the enemies of stability here
           | 
           | On top of that, server ram has a higher expectation of
           | cooling quality than consumer, which can be anything goes.
